Handbill: Finnocchio’s East, October 1977

Date1977 October
Mediumpaper, printed ink
DimensionsPrimary Dimensions (overall height x width): 11 × 8 1/2in. (27.9 × 21.6cm)
ClassificationsInformation Artifacts
Credit LineThompson R. Harlow Fund
DescriptionHandbill or flyer Finnocchio’s East located at 165 Dexter Ave., West Hartford for a Halloween costume ball, October 7 & 28, 1977. It has black text printed on yellow paper.

Printed on front: "FINNOCCHIO'S / EAST / Proudly / Presents / IVAN THE TERRIBLE / FIRST two HALLOWEEN / COSTUMES BALL / OCT. 7 Levy and GLITTER ball / OCT. 28 All kinds of costumes / special Prize for the / Foxiest, "real" girl and most / Masculine GUY cash and trophies / Both costume balls WILL have / CASH and TROPHIES, $75. 50. 20. 10. / COVER CHARGE $3. / Free BUFFETT / Great Disco / tickets at the Bar / 165 DEXTER AVE WEST HARTFORD / Off New Park and Oakwood Ave 527-1957."
Object number2025.5.3
NotesSubject Note: Finocchio's East was a gay club in West Hartford in the mid-1970s.
